Technology kids

I sometimes marvel at the level of understanding our kids have with technology... from figuring out our lock screen patterns to downloading and installing games from Google Play - and they can't even read, but they can correctly guess what the X or install buttons do.

Sometimes I have to force take the tablets away from them as they can spend hours non stop on it... what will there kids be like I ask myself.

Kids of today are much less physically active playing games and more and more glued to the technology... from playing games to coloring in to learning shapes/maths or even how to be a doctor.

Maybe it's not such a bad thing, I guess only the future will tell what the influence of technology at such a early has on them.
